#462517 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#462517 is composed of 27.5% red, 14.5% green and 9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 47.1% magenta, 67.1% yellow and 72.5% black. It has a hue angle of 17.9 degrees, a saturation of 50.5% and a lightness of 18.2%. #462517 color hex could be obtained by blending #8c4a2e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333300.

#462517 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#462517 has RGB values of R:70, G:37, B:23 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.47, Y:0.67, K:0.73. Its decimal value is 4597015.

Shades and Tints of #462517
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0604 is the darkest color, while #fefcf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#462517
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#312e2c is the less saturated color, while #5b1c02 is the most saturated one.
